在数字化时代,移动端应用的开发已经成为趋势。HTML5作为一种跨平台的技术,为移动端应用开发提供了便捷的解决方案。本文将带你从HTML5的入门到精通,详细了解如何轻松实现移动端应用开发。
第一章:HTML5概述
1.1 HTML5是什么?
HTML5是超文本标记语言(HTML)的最新版本,它提供了更加丰富的网页功能,支持更多多媒体和图形展示,以及更好的交互性。HTML5的出现,使得网页开发更加高效和便捷。
1.2 HTML5的特点
- 跨平台:HTML5可以在各种设备上运行,包括智能手机、平板电脑、电脑等。
- 丰富性:支持更多多媒体和图形展示,如音频、视频、canvas等。
- 交互性:提供更好的交互体验,如触摸、手势等。
- 兼容性:兼容大部分浏览器,降低开发难度。
第二章:HTML5基础知识
2.1 HTML5结构
HTML5主要由以下部分组成:
- 文档类型声明(Doctype):指定文档的版本。
- 根元素(html):包含整个文档的所有内容。
- 头部元素(head):包含文档的元信息,如标题、字符编码等。
- 主体元素(body):包含文档的可视内容,如标题、段落、图片等。
2.2 HTML5标签
HTML5提供了许多新的标签,如<article>, <section>, <header>, <footer>等,使得文档结构更加清晰。
2.3 HTML5属性
HTML5增加了一些新的属性,如data-*、contenteditable等,提高了标签的功能。
第三章:CSS3与HTML5结合
3.1 CSS3概述
CSS3是层叠样式表(CSS)的下一个版本,提供了丰富的样式设计功能。
3.2 CSS3与HTML5结合
CSS3可以与HTML5结合,实现各种样式效果,如阴影、圆角、动画等。
第四章:JavaScript与HTML5互动
4.1 JavaScript概述
JavaScript是一种客户端脚本语言,可以增强网页的交互性。
4.2 JavaScript与HTML5互动
JavaScript可以与HTML5结合,实现各种动态效果,如滚动、点击、拖拽等。
第五章:移动端HTML5应用开发
5.1 移动端HTML5开发框架
移动端HTML5开发框架可以帮助开发者快速开发应用,如Bootstrap、jQuery Mobile等。
5.2 移动端HTML5开发技巧
- 响应式设计:适应不同设备的屏幕尺寸。
- 优化性能:减少页面加载时间,提高用户体验。
- 跨平台兼容性:确保应用在各种设备上都能正常运行。
第六章:HTML5移动端应用实战
6.1 示例:制作一个简单的移动端应用
以下是一个简单的HTML5移动端应用的代码示例:
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>我的移动端应用</title>
<style>
/* 样式设置 */
</style>
</head>
<body>
<header>
<h1>我的移动端应用</h1>
</header>
<section>
<h2>关于我们</h2>
<p>这里是我们公司的介绍...</p>
</section>
<footer>
<p>版权所有 © 2022</p>
</footer>
</body>
</html>
6.2 实战经验分享
- 学习资源:推荐学习网站、论坛、书籍等。
- 实践项目:通过实践项目积累经验。
- 交流分享:参加技术交流,结识同行。
第七章:总结与展望
HTML5移动端应用开发具有广泛的应用前景。掌握HTML5技术,将有助于你在这个领域取得更好的成绩。随着技术的不断发展,HTML5将为我们带来更多惊喜。让我们共同期待HTML5的未来!
本文从HTML5的概述、基础知识、CSS3结合、JavaScript互动、移动端开发框架等方面,全面介绍了HTML5网页小程序开发。希望本文能帮助你从入门到精通,轻松实现移动端应用开发。祝你学习愉快!
